“So this whole movement is about rightly saying we need to take a look at these budgets and figure out whether it reflects the right priorities,” Harris told New York radio program “Ebro in the Morning” on June 9, 2020.

“Defund the police–” she continued, “–the issue behind it is that we need to reimagine how we are creating safety”:

And when you have many cities that have one-third of their entire city budget focused on policing, we know that is not the smart way and the best way or the right way to achieve safety. For too long, the status quo thinking has been you get more safety by putting more cops on the street. Well, that’s wrong, because, by the way, if you want to look at upper middle class suburban neighborhoods, they don’t have that patrol car.

In a subsequent part of the interview, she asserted that American cities were “increasing the militarization of police” while also advocating for “reallocating funds from public schools.”

According to a 2020 Pew Research poll, only 25 percent of Americans were in favor of reducing police budgets. By 2021, support for defunding the police had declined to 15 percent.

Harris had previously expressed support for the defund the police movement, as evidenced by a video posted by the Republican National Committee’s Research Team in 2020.

In the video, Harris applauded former Los Angeles Mayor Eric Garcetti’s decision to defund the city’s police.

Additionally, during a June 26, 2020 interview on Watch What Happens Live, Harris asserted that increasing the number of police officers on the streets was unjust.

“For far too long, the status quo thinking has been to believe that by putting more police on the street, you’re going to have more safety. And that’s just wrong. That’s not how it works,” she said.

In 2021, Harris, as vice president, said, “It is wrong-headed thinking to think that the only way you’re going to get communities to be safe is to put more police officers on the street.”
